在当今数字化时代,人工智能(AI)正逐渐成为改变各行各业的驱动力之一。银行业作为金融行业的重要组成部分,也正经历着由AI引领的变革。本文将深入探讨AI如何革新银行客户服务,提升效率与体验。
一、AI在客户服务中的应用
1. 客户服务机器人
客户服务机器人是AI在银行客户服务中最直观的应用之一。这些机器人能够通过自然语言处理(NLP)技术,与客户进行对话,解答常见问题,如账户余额查询、转账操作等。以下是一个简单的代码示例,展示如何使用NLP构建一个基础的客户服务机器人:
class CustomerServiceBot:
def __init__(self):
self.knowledge_base = {
"余额查询": "您的账户余额为XXX元。",
"转账操作": "请提供转账金额和收款人信息。",
# 更多常见问题的回答
}
def get_response(self, query):
if query in self.knowledge_base:
return self.knowledge_base[query]
else:
return "很抱歉,我无法回答您的问题。"
# 使用示例
bot = CustomerServiceBot()
print(bot.get_response("我的余额是多少?"))
2. 个性化推荐
通过分析客户的交易历史和偏好,AI能够为客户提供个性化的金融产品和服务推荐。这种个性化推荐不仅能提高客户满意度,还能增加银行的收入。
3. 智能客服系统
智能客服系统能够自动识别客户的请求,并在数秒内提供相应的解决方案。这大大减少了客户的等待时间,提高了服务效率。
二、AI提升银行客户服务的效率
1. 自动化流程
AI可以帮助银行自动化许多常规任务,如贷款审批、信用卡申请等。这不仅提高了工作效率,还减少了人为错误的可能性。
2. 风险管理
通过分析大量的交易数据,AI可以帮助银行识别潜在的风险,如欺诈行为。以下是一个简单的代码示例,展示如何使用机器学习进行欺诈检测:
from sklearn.model_selection import train_test_split
from sklearn.ensemble import RandomForestClassifier
# 假设已有交易数据
data = ... # 数据预处理
X = data[:, :-1] # 特征
y = data[:, -1] # 标签
# 划分训练集和测试集
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=42)
# 训练模型
model = RandomForestClassifier()
model.fit(X_train, y_train)
# 评估模型
accuracy = model.score(X_test, y_test)
print(f"模型准确率:{accuracy}")
3. 实时分析
AI能够实时分析客户数据,为客户提供个性化的服务和建议。例如,当客户在手机银行上浏览某一产品时,AI可以立即推荐相关的金融服务。
三、AI提升银行客户服务的体验
1. 个性化体验
通过了解客户的需求和偏好,AI可以为客户提供更加个性化的服务,从而提升客户满意度。
2. 快速响应
AI可以帮助银行快速响应用户的需求,减少客户等待时间,提高服务效率。
3. 便捷操作
AI驱动的自助服务功能,如手机银行、网上银行等,让客户能够更加便捷地进行金融操作。
四、总结
AI在银行客户服务中的应用,不仅提升了服务效率,还改善了客户体验。随着技术的不断发展,相信AI将在未来为银行业带来更多惊喜。
